    Decapattack (Sega Genesis, 1991) Game Decap Attack
    24 déc. 2017
    Weird and Wonderful
    Way back in the day when you could make a game about literally "anything", this curious little gem came along. The story is absurd, your character is mummy with a head in his stomach used for punching, and you have a second head used as a projectile. Jumping and smashing enemies is satisfying. Only gripe is that when you die, you go all the way back to the *beginning* of the stage! All in all though, if you're tired of derivative games, give DECAP ATTACK a try.
    02 juil. 2010
    Number 3 is superior
    I really want to like THUNDER FORCE II. The horizontal scrolling sections are awesome and have that familiar THUNDER FORCE flair, but these alternate between overhead stages that, rather than being standard vertical scrolling sections with fixed paths, allow free roaming. Finding where you're supposed to go in these parts can be a pain to say the least. THUNDER FORCE III is far better, but II is not too bad for collectors.
